Deriving the Electron Density of the Solar Corona from the Inversion of Total Brightness Measurements
DOI: 10.1086/319029 Bibcode: 2001ApJ...548.1081H

Howard, R. A.; Vourlidas, A.; Hayes, A. P.

Usually, the electron density structure of the white-light solar corona is estimated from the inversion of polarized brightness measurements. The inversion technique was developed in the 1950s and has remained largely unchanged since. The Distance to the Vela Pulsar Gauged with Hubble Space Telescope Parallax Observations
DOI: 10.1086/323377 Bibcode: 2001ApJ...561..930C

Caraveo, P. A.; Bignami, G. F.; De Luca, A. +1 more

The distance to the Vela pulsar (PSR B0833-45) has been traditionally assumed to be 500 pc. Although affected by a significant uncertainty, this value stuck to both the pulsar and the supernova remnant.
